Sda6 this partition most likely contains the windows diagnostic environment Sda5 this partition contains the recovery image for Windows, this is normally accessed by pressing a button during the POST screen, leave it be in case you ever want to go back to windows.

linux vm on windows

Sda4 this partition might be the dell diagnostic tools, most OEMs have them. Sda3 is the windows partition, if you are going to install linux. Sda2 is some partition microsoft uses, I do not know whats inside it as I never ran Win10 to open the volume. Sda1 is the standard EFI partition, linux can also add files to this so you can leave it be. and life would a lot easier if I could do it via a VM instead of shutdown, reboot, spend 5 min in windows, shutdown, rebooot.
